stefan Giuseppe Aruta schrieb: > Hi all, > I made an alternative EXE file to run OJ on Windows (OJ.EXE). > This EXE basically launches the openjump.bat file in the BIN directory. It > doesn't substitute it. > This file in attached at this mail: REname OJ.ZI to OJ.ZIP and decompres it. > > How I made it: > 1) create another batch file in the BIN directory called RUN.BAT with only > one line (=openjump.bat) > 2) I use "Bat to exe converter" to transform this RUN.BAT in OJ.EXE file.I > set these parameters on "Bat to exe converter": the batch file to convert > (RUN.BAT) , the icon, ghost application. RUN.BAT and the icon files are > included in the OJ.ZIP files, in the folder RESOURCES > > > > How to use it: > Just put OJ.EXE file in your Openjump/BIN folder and click on it to launch > OpenJUMP. DON'T delate OpenJUMP.bat file. > > > I made this alternative EXE file after reading many posts of users where the > answer was the same: set correct parameters in bat file, don't use exe file, > use the batch one. > The idea is that OpeOJ.EXE launch the program reading openjump.bat file: the > latest becames a sort of INI file. > Thus, in the next time that users ask about memory, language or other > problems, we can simply answer to set the correct parametres in the batch > file, without delating/not using the exe one. > > Of coarse this idea is not really elegant but it works.
